8440 Morganford Rd St. Louis, MO 63123

Call Now: 314-638-5700

Quick & Easy Financing

Weber Road Sales Site Map - www.weberroadsales.com

Weber Road Sales Selling Used Cars in St. Louis, MO.

Weber Road Sales - www.weberroadsales.com/
Current Preowned Inventory - www.weberroadsales.com/vehicle